FARM FRESH: Bananas being loaded at a vegetable market in Kochi. India is the largest producer of banana with an annual production of 16.8 million tonnes.

Horticulture makes up 28.5 per cent of the country's agriculture GDP. Fresh fruit exports during April-February of the last fiscal were $209.10 million against $159.31 million during the year-ago period.
